The cuisine is one of the main reasons to visit Bologna. Delicious pasta, homemade tortellini, mortadella, and flavourful balsamic vinegar and Parmigiano reggiano. The many traditional foods of Bologna has made it the gastronomic capital of Italy – which says quite a lot.
In this post, I’ll be sharing the 10 most traditional foods in Bologna, the best restaurants, food shops and markets, and finally a great food tour and cooking class.
